🧐 Who’s Rei Kawakubo Anyway? The Fashion Enigma
Meet Rei Kawakubo, the brain behind Comme des Garçons (French for "like the boys"). Born in Tokyo, she’s not your typical runway queen. Her designs are polarizing – think asymmetrical cuts, black-on-black palettes, and clothes that look like they crawled out of a dystopian dream. 💀🖤 Some call her a genius; others say, "Wait... is that even wearable?" But one thing’s clear: Kawakubo doesn’t play by the rules. Instead, she rewrites them entirely. So, what does this mean for her brand? Is it haute couture or just plain weird? Let’s find out! 🤔
🌟 Why People Love (and Hate) Comme des Garçons
Love it or hate it, Comme des Garçons has been shaking up the fashion world since 1969. Fans adore its avant-garde aesthetic – those bubble dresses from the ’80s? Game-changing. Detractors argue it’s too conceptual, more art than clothing. And then there’s Play, the playful red heart collection that somehow feels accessible yet still undeniably cool. 🫂✨ For many, CDG represents rebellion against fast fashion and cookie-cutter styles. But let’s face it – if you’re rocking a $1,500 sweater that looks half-eaten, you better have confidence oozing out of every pore. 👗🔥
💰 Is Comme des Garçons Worth the Price Tag?
This is where things get tricky. With prices ranging from $300 t-shirts to four-figure jackets, Comme des Garçons isn’t exactly budget-friendly. But here’s the kicker: It’s less about functionality and more about making a statement. If you see fashion as an extension of self-expression, investing in a piece from their Dover Street Market might feel totally worth it. Plus, resale value can be sky-high among collectors. However, if you’re looking for practicality over philosophy, you might want to stick with Zara. 😉💸
